Adam Sandler does national tours, which is news to me, as is this, that his latest tour, titled the “You’re My Best Friend Tour,” is coming to Charlottesville in September.

My rule with these kinds of things is, usually, even if I don’t care much for the act in question, if it’s a big name, gotta go.

But with Adam Sandler, I dunno.

The date for the show at the John Paul Jones Arena is Friday, Sept. 12.

I’m actually impressed that they included JPJ on this one.

Tickets are going on presale today at noon, with the general on-sale beginning at noon on Friday, at Ticketmaster.com.

The presser from the Sandler PR folks tells us that Sandler did tours in 2022 and 2023 that were both fully sold-out, which, good for him.

This one starts on Sept. 5 and will take Sandler to 30 cities.

The presser tells us that “highly anticipated ‘Happy Gilmore 2’” will be streaming on Netflix on July 25.
